Powder Puff coats, help!
When working with the Powder Puff keep in mind that this is a double coated breed and requires a special attention. They do look beautiful in their long draping coats but remember that part is grooming products and the other part is genetic. Hi I live with a heavily double coated powderpuff named Collins and he has lots of hair, my mom makes sure that she grooms him frequently to avoid matting. She also uses the ultra deep conditioner with a tablespoon of ultra silk cream mixed in well and does not rinse any of the products out. His coat is very pourous and requires daily hydrating sprays.
